This role will be responsible for ensuring a sufficient material supply for clinical and commercial programs at the site, working with cross-functioning teams to mitigate any material risks. Responsibilities range from enrollment of new materials to ensuring timely release of materials for manufacturing.

What You Will Achieve

In this role, you will:

  • Responsible for documenting material requirements and ensuring adequate supply in support of commercial and clinical manufacturing. 

  • Identifies and escalates material supply or release risks that may impact the manufacturing schedule.

  • Perform inventory/supply analysis in support of production scenario analysis.

  • Responsible for preparing draft BOMs for clinical programs and submitting the request for the SAP BOM.

  • Loads independent demand in order for buyer(s) to create purchase orders for materials.

  • Initiates enrollment of materials per Clinical Manufacturing program needs.

  • Lead efforts to implement new or alternative materials with existing suppliers.

Sunshine Act

Pfizer reports payments and other transfers of value to health care providers as required by federal and state transparency laws and implementing regulations.  These laws and regulations require Pfizer to provide government agencies with information such as a health care provider’s name, address and the type of payments or other value received, generally for public disclosure.  Subject to further legal review and statutory or regulatory clarification, which Pfizer intends to pursue, reimbursement of recruiting expenses for licensed physicians may constitute a reportable transfer of value under the federal transparency law commonly known as the Sunshine Act.  Therefore, if you are a licensed physician who incurs recruiting expenses as a result of interviewing with Pfizer that we pay or reimburse, your name, address and the amount of payments made currently will be reported to the government.  If you have questions regarding this matter, please do not hesitate to contact your Talent Acquisition representative.
